ABC‘s Agents of SHIELD Face My Enemy Review. Marvel’s SHIELD: The Agents of S.H.I.E.L.D. Podcast: Season 2, Episode 4: Face My Enemy is an audio podcast review in which FilmBook contributor Mike Smith discusses his reaction the latest episode of ABC’s Agents of SHIELD.

Agents of SHIELD: Season 2, Episode 4: Face My Enemy‘s plot synopsis (spoilers): “Coulson and May go undercover to a charity function to get a painting that is carved with alien symbols, and encounter Talbot, who has already claimed it, and asks to meet with Coulson in private. Coulson sends May to scout ahead, and she discovers the brainwashed S.H.I.E.L.D. Agent 33 in Talbot’s hotel room, realizing that the Talbot at the party was actually Bakshi in disguise. Bakshi tortures May while Agent 33 disguises herself as May to pick up Coulson and sabotage the Bus. Coulson realizes that “May” is a fake because of inconsistencies in her behavior. He rescues the real May, who defeats Agent 33, while Fitz and Hunter work together to save the Bus from Hydra’s computer virus, allowing Fitz to start reintegrating into the team following previous life-changing injuries. Though Bakshi escapes, S.H.I.E.L.D. claims the painting, hiding its survival from the real Talbot. Raina is later confronted by Whitehall, who orders her to deliver the Obelisk to Hydra or face death.”

Agents of SHIELD: Season 2, Episode 4: Face My Enemy stars Clark Gregg, Ming-na Wen, Brett Dalton, Chloe Bennett, Ian de Caestecker, Elizabeth Henstridge, Nick Blood, B.J. Britt, Henry Simmons, Reed Diamond, and Kyle MacLachlan.
